Moving on to blue steels, Blue #2 is a bit tougher, meaning it is less prone to edge damage and known for superior edge retention. Aogami Super is a high-performance Blue Steel, that is a bit more stain resistant and offers the best edge retention of the group. Blue #2 Steel. This group of knives uses Blue #2 steel, also called Aogami #2 and sometimes called Blue Paper #2 since the steel is wrapped in blue paper when it's sent to blacksmiths. This steel is sought after and made from Japanese pure sand irons at their famous Yasugi plant in Shimane Prefecture. It outperforms Shirogami (White) steel with.

Blue #2 has been, in my experience, much less reactive and easier to maintain than White steel or other swedish carbon steels. If it's stainless clad with a Blue #2 core, maintenance will be a breeze. If it's iron clad and reactive, just use the knife as you normally would and give it a wipe after use and before setting it down.

Aogami Super: High-performance Blue Steel. Aogami Super is an upgraded version of Aogami 2, designed for improved performance. It contains higher levels of carbon and alloying elements, resulting in a harder, more wear-resistant steel that is highly sought after by knife makers and enthusiasts alike.. What is '. Blue Steel #2. '? Blue Steel No.2 (Hitachi Metals Ltd.) is made by adding Chromium and Tungsten / Wolfram to White Steel No.2. This results in increased toughness and the production of hard carbide molecules which improve edge retention. The Blue paper steel is manufactured in three grades; #1, #2, and super high carbon steel. Blue steel #1 also known as Aogami #1 steel. Blue steel #1 has the same amount of Carbon as White steel #1 but with added Chromium and tungsten. It has a hardness of 61-64HRC as per the Rockwell hardness scale.

Generated 90126903 times. Blue 2 (Hitachi) - Ref. Kitchen Knife Steel FAQ - Also referred as Ao-Ko II. Hitachi high carbon steel, specifically developed for tools and knives. Very pure alloy - P <= 0.025%, S <= 0.004%. In my experience very good steel, just like its brother Aogami 1 steel.

The Difference Between Aogami #2 And Aogami Super Blue. The Queen of the steels - Aogami Blue Super (Hitachi Metals Ltd.) is one of the greatest Japanese Carbon Steels. In addition to containing more Carbon, Chromium and Tungsten than Blue Steel No.1, it also includes Molybdenum. It has a very good edge sharpness and excellent edge retention.
